Wineries in Paso Robles: Eberle Winery
If you’re looking for wineries in Paso Robles to visit on a budget, then Eberle Winery is an excellent choice for the best wineries in Paso Robles.
They offer free winery tours, which allows you to see how the wines here are made for no cost! What’s more, you’ll be able to taste the wines for free too!
You may think that a virtually free winery would offer less than impressive wines. However, the wines here are among the best on our list of the top wineries in Paso Robles.
Be aware that there is a charge for groups over 10, however, any visiting groups under this number will enjoy their session for free!
With amazing grounds, a fascinating wine cave, and access to easy transport links, Eberle Winery is one of the wineries in Paso Robles that you won’t regret visiting.

L’Aventure Winery
Next on our list of wineries in Paso Robles, it’s L’Adventure Winery.
Known as one of the most aesthetic wineries in Paso Robles, L’Aventure Winery is deserving of a spot on anyone’s to-do list.
Originally a barley farm, this beautiful spot was transformed by Stephen Asseo to become a sprawling winery that offers visitors a tasting room, wine cave, and extensive outdoor vineyard. This is a wonderful choice for wineries in Paso Robles.
Although the tasting room and general look of the place is impressive, it’s the addition of new varietals into the wines here that makes L’Aventure one of the most intriguing wineries in Paso Robles.
This place promises fascinating notes and blends in every wine, and we guarantee you’ll walk away with a new favorite bottle or two!

Le Cuvier
Another great pick for wineries in Paso Robles, is Le Cuvier.
With perfect views of the Paso Robles hills, Le Cuvier is the perfect spot for wiling away an afternoon. Although some wineries can be hit and miss when it comes to flavor, Le Cuvier has quality wines that never disappoint. It’s a fantastic pick for wineries in Paso Robles.
As well as being one of top wineries in Paso Robles when it comes to taste, this spot is also incredibly stunning. Seriously, the views from the top of the winery are unmatched!
If you want to do a tasting while you’re here, be sure to book in advance. Costing $15 a person, this tasting is reasonably priced.
However, it becomes even more reasonable when you find out that the cost is waived if you buy a bottle of wine! Definitely add this to your to-do list for wineries in Paso Robles.

Halter Ranch
If you want to feel the wind in your hair and sip some top-quality wines while you’re visiting wineries in Paso Robles, then you need to check out Halter Ranch.
Known for its quaint, countryside atmosphere, this is one of the best wineries in Paso Robles for those who want to escape from the hustle and bustle of metropolitan cities.
There are several tasting tours on offer here, and each one is approximately 45 minutes long and gives you ample opportunity to learn about the area’s founding and try their many wines.
If you want to take things to the next level, this is one of the wineries in Paso Robles that offers a horseback riding tour! So, if you’re feeling adventurous, give this interesting alternative a try.

Summerwood Winery & Inn
Slightly smaller than some of the other wineries in Paso Robles, Summerwood Winery and Inn is the perfect place to visit for those short on time.
Owned by the Fukae family, this winery is known for its ostentatious, pricey wines. With Bordeaux and Diosa Blanc varieties among the offerings, it’s unsurprising that the price per bottle can get a little hefty.
However, if you’d like to just try things out, their actual tasting sessions are super reasonable – so don’t stress! This might end up being one of your favorite wineries in Paso Robles.
Niner Wine Estates
Next on our list of wineries in Paso Robles, it’s Niner Wine Estates.
Perfectly balancing sustainability and aesthetics, Niner Wine Estates is one of the top wineries in Paso Robles that you can visit.
The wines themselves are delicious, but it’s the gorgeous tasting room that takes the cake. Featuring a toasty fireplace, high ceilings, and stone architecture, it’s one of the wineries in Paso Robles that’s known for its beauty.
However, it’s not just Niner’s looks that makes it one for the books. This winery in Paso Robles is also incredibly sustainable and has dedicated solar paneling, meaning they don’t waste a single scrap of energy.
Sensationally designed and offering some of the most delicious wines in the area, this is one of the wineries in Paso Robles that keeps guests coming back.
